Marion Jane PETTY 1900–1903 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 10 Oct 1900

Birth Location: Edinburgh, Midlothian, Scotland

Death Date: 23 Mar 1903

Death Location: Edinburgh, Midlothian, Scotland

Father: William PETTY

Mother: Jessie Watson

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

Marion Jane PETTY was born in 1900 in Edinburgh, Midlothian, Scotland, the child of William Petty And Jessie Watson. Marion Jane PETTY passed away in 1903 in Edinburgh, Midlothian, Scotland.
